Architects, Except Landscape and Naval Salary in North Carolina
Ranked #21 of 51 · NC
1.9% below U.S. average
Mean annual salary $104,270 ≈ $50/hr
Median annual salary $95,700
Employment 2,980
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)
P10 $64,730P25 $79,010 Median $95,700P75 $122,960P90 $164,270
About 80% of architects, except landscape and navals in North Carolina earn between $64,730 and $164,270.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ean architects, except landscape and naval salary in North Carolina is $104,270, about 1.9% below the U.S. average ($106,260). That works out to roughly $50/hr at 2,080 hours per year.
Metro Areas in North Carolina
| Metro area | Median | Mean | Employment |
|---|---|---|---|
| Asheville, NC | $103,100 | $103,950 | 120 |
| Charlotte-Concord-Gastonia, NC-SC | $98,620 | $105,970 | 1,340 |
| Durham-Chapel Hill, NC | $98,620 | $112,700 | 230 |
| Greensboro-High Point, NC | $96,040 | $101,800 | 90 |
| Wilmington, NC | $93,720 | $98,680 | 80 |
| Raleigh-Cary, NC | $91,570 | $104,420 | 790 |
| Western North Carolina nonmetropolitan area | $83,410 | $92,170 | 70 |
| Eastern North Carolina nonmetropolitan area | $80,990 | $92,460 | 50 |
